Django is a high-level Python web framework that encourages rapid development and clean, pragmatic design. It is known for its simplicity, flexibility, and robustness and is widely used by developers to build web applications and websites.
In this tutorial, we will focus on a specific Django library called j’rêve c’est mieux, which provides additional features and functionalities to enhance the development experience with Django.
- Getting started with Django:
Before we move on to using the j’rêve c’est mieux library, make sure you have Django installed on your system. You can install Django using pip by running the following command:
pip install Django
To create a new Django project, run the following command in your terminal:
django-admin startproject myproject
Navigate to the project directory and start the Django development server by running the following command:
python manage.py runserver
You should see a "Congratulations!" message indicating that the Django development server is running successfully. Now, you can access your Django project at http://127.0.0.1:8000.
- Installing j’rêve c’est mieux with Django:
To install the j’rêve c’est mieux library with Django, you need to first add it to your project’s requirements. Open your project’srequirements.txt
file and add the following line:
jrevecestmieux==0.1.0
Then, run the following command to install the library:
pip install -r requirements.txt
Next, add the jrevecestmieux
app to your Django project’s settings. Open the settings.py
file in your project directory and add 'jrevecestmieux'
to the INSTALLED_APPS
list:
INSTALLED_APPS = [
...
'jrevecestmieux',
]
Save the changes and run the following command to apply the migrations for the j’rêve c’est mieux library:
python manage.py migrate
- Using j’rêve c’est mieux in Django:
The j’rêve c’est mieux library provides several useful features that can enhance the development experience with Django. Here are some of the key features of the library:
-
Custom template tags and filters: j’rêve c’est mieux provides a set of custom template tags and filters that can be used in your Django templates to simplify and enhance the presentation of data.
-
Utilities for working with forms: The library includes utilities for working with forms in Django, such as custom form fields, validators, and form sets.
- Internationalization support: j’rêve c’est mieux provides utilities for supporting internationalization in your Django project, making it easy to translate your application into different languages.
To use these features in your Django project, simply import the relevant modules from the jrevecestmieux
library and use them in your code. For example, you can use custom template tags and filters in your Django templates by importing them like this:
{% load jrevecestmieux_tags %}
- Extending j’rêve c’est mieux:
One of the great things about Django is its extensibility, and the same applies to the j’rêve c’est mieux library. You can extend the library by creating your custom template tags, filters, form fields, validators, and other utilities.
To create a custom template tag with j’rêve c’est mieux, define a Python function and decorate it with the @register.simple_tag
decorator from the jrevecestmieux
library. For example:
from django import template
register = template.Library()
@register.simple_tag
def custom_tag():
return "Hello, custom tag!"
You can then use this custom template tag in your Django templates by loading it with the load
tag and calling it like this:
{% load my_custom_tags %}
{% custom_tag %}
- Conclusion:
In this tutorial, we have covered the basics of using the j’rêve c’est mieux library with Django. We have seen how to install the library, use its features, and extend it with custom functionalities. By leveraging the j’rêve c’est mieux library, you can enhance your Django projects with additional features and utilities, making them more robust and efficient.
I hope this tutorial has been helpful in getting you started with j’rêve c’est mieux and exploring its capabilities. Happy coding with Django and j’rêve c’est mieux!
MON SON ALL TIME MERCI DJANGO. MERCI DE DIRE CE QUON RESSENT POUR NOUS. TU ARRIVES A METTRE DES MOTS SUR NOUS MAUX ET CA CEST MAGNIFIQUE. MERCI
Décidément, j'aime vraiment bien le Django, mais il fût tellement percutant , que tout ce qu'il sort en ce moment m'ennuie.
il a un tell charisme, et quelque chose qui sort de l'ordinaire, qu'il n'utilises plus, ces sont m'ennuie, c'est dommage mais j'ai écouté tout l'album et je retrouve plus le django que j'ai kiffé d'en temps. Grosse déception ,et cest mon avis.
Force.
🙏
❤️
Catharsis
il fais dla musique selon ses moods donc faut attendre qui change d’humeur si on aime pas lol
T’es le seul artiste qui m’a poussé à assumer d’avoir son propre aesthetic dans sa musique 🦾
dors c'est mieux
Un chef d'oeuvre, une authenticité totale, merci comme d'hab django
Merci mon frère j'en pleur tellement c beau 💪 des larmes de Phoenix.
Boss
Très très lourd 🥲 très beau texte et quel mélancolie #perfect
C est quoi cette vie où on doit niqué pou un câlin ben srx mec tu m as touché la …. Je pensais être le seule a pensé sa encore de nos jours … 💪🏽💪🏽💪🏽 Courage pas facile d être seule au final alors qu on est si "bien entouré" …
Meilleur son de l'album je vous assure 😢 je kiff en boucle
J'fais genre j'm'en sors, une voix m'répète : "À quoi ça sert ?"
Putain mec d'ou est ce que tu nous ramènes ces mots 🎩🎩
Il y avait des textes incroyables dans l’album précédent. Là, j’ai l’impression d’un homme qui ne cesse de manger du fast-food et devient opulent et ne peut recracher que ce qu’il a mangé.
Les textes sur les orages me rappellent mon poème de primaire.
Merci Panda Pour m'avoir partagé ce Banger 🤯😎
Mais cet album Django…une dinguerie ! gros soutien à toi vraiment, la dépression est un putain d'fléau !
Encore merci..🖤🖤